Business Context and Reporting Period
This Form 8-K filing by Broadridge Financial Solutions, Inc. (Broadridge) reports on events occurring on August 3, 2026, and the announcement of financial results for the fourth quarter and fiscal year ended June 30, 2026. The company operates as a provider of financial services technology and solutions.
Key Financial Metrics and Capital Allocation
The filing text does not provide specific numerical values for revenue, profit, cash flow, margins, debt, or liquidity. These metrics are referenced as being detailed in the attached Press Release (Exhibit 99.1) and Earnings Presentation (Exhibit 99.2), which are not included in the source text.
However, the filing details significant capital allocation actions:
- Dividend Declaration: The Board declared a quarterly dividend of $1.09 per share, payable on October 5, 2026, to stockholders of record on September 3, 2026.
- Dividend Increase: This declaration represents a 12% increase in the annual dividend from $3.90 to $4.36 per share.
- Share Repurchase Program: The Board authorized a new program to repurchase up to $1.5 billion of outstanding common stock. This replaces the remaining 3.5 million shares under the prior authorization.
Material Changes and Strategic Actions
The primary material changes reported in this filing relate to capital return strategies rather than operational performance metrics:
- Dividend Growth: A 12% year-over-year increase in the annualized dividend rate.
- Repurchase Authorization: A substantial new authorization of $1.5 billion for share buybacks, indicating a shift in capital deployment priorities or confidence in future cash flows.
Guidance, Outlook, and Risks
The filing contains forward-looking statements regarding the timing and execution of the share repurchase program, noting that repurchases depend on market conditions, stock price, liquidity, and capital allocation priorities. The program has no expiration date and may be suspended or modified at the Board's discretion.
Management highlighted several risk factors that could cause actual results to differ from expectations:
- Changes in laws and regulations affecting clients or services.
- Reliance on a relatively small number of clients and their financial health.
- Material security breaches or cybersecurity attacks.
- Declines in securities market participation and activity.
- Failure of key service providers or system disruptions.
- Geopolitical conditions and competitive pressures.
- Ability to retain key personnel and keep pace with technology changes.
